MILL CREEK — A serial Rite Aid and pharmacy robbery suspect reportedly struck again Monday night.

The man, described as being in his 20s or 30s, reportedly robbed the Rite Aid at the Thomas Lake Shopping Center on April 23. He is believed to be the same person responsible for robberies at Rite Aid stores and pharmacies in Mill Creek, Bothell and Lynnwood over the past several months.

The suspect is about 5 feet 9 inches tall and has brown or light-blond hair and green eyes.
